For Sale: Customized Schwinn Heavy Duti bicycle

Hello friends, it’s time to part with this bicycle. There is nothing wrong with the bike, and everything is mechanically sound as far as I know. It isn’t the cleanest of bikes, as it probably sat outside quite a bit in its former life as a factory bike at an aluminum mill. But it boasts many new parts and has been optimized for city riding and utility use.

This circa 1996 Schwinn Heavy Duti is a “one-size” deal that should fit folks from 5’3″ to 6′. (I’m 5’8″.) This cantilever style frame was used for about five years at a mill in Longview, Washington and shows evidence of its “fleet bike” youth in the nameplate on rear seatstays and rear fender. It is by no means a lightweight bike!

Some specs:

  • 26 inch wheels (559) currently sporting plump Schwalbe Fat Frank tires (60-559)
  • Front Wald basket and rear rack with “rat trap”
  • Fork came off of an ’80s mountain bike to allow for canti brakes
  • Rear wheel laced around a Sturmey-Archer three speed XRD-3 hub with drum brake
  • Chromoly bullmoose handlebars with Ergon grips
  • ABUS cafe lock on rear wheel, comes with integrated chain
  • Rear rack mounted Spanninga tail light

Basically this bike is ready to go for in town adventures–you just need to provide a front light and a bell!
